gurujuan Posted March 20, 2019 Share Posted March 20, 2019 Who knows what will happen. In his recent past, Bruce has always preferred a quick mobile striker to lead the line, think Tammy Abraham, Abel Hernandez, so I wouldn’t be surprised to see him bring in that type of player Will he fancy Rhodes? He might do, but maybe not as a starter. He didn’t really use McCormack or Hogan, other than from the bench, and that’s the way Norwich have utilised Jordan Rhodes. For me, if Rhodes or Winnall want to be regular starters, they need to look at clubs with lower aspirations If we are going to bring in the type of centre forward that Bruce likes, we need to make room, so those two could go. Will we be able to find buyers? Yes, I would think so, but we’ll probably have to take a massive cut, at least in the case of Rhodes. Hooper and Matias are out of contract, and will undoubtably get fixed up elsewhere. A fit Hooper, would be a loss, but could we really offer him another big contract That leaves Fletcher, Nuhiu, Joao and Forestieri, who, along with a new Tammy Abraham type, would give us the options we need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
